Default Another Trailer Consideration

Like I said lots of opinions. Another consideration for a trailer is the anticipated ramps. All the Fla ramps I used had a dock alongside. Not so on SC lakes I use, which have a dock nearby, but not adjacent. So instead of guiding the boat onto the trailer with docklines, my wife had to learn to drive onto the Hitchhiker float on type trailer. I pull out about 5’ of winch strap at which point the stern is still floating and the boat load is fwd/over the trailer axles. An advantage with having the dock not next to the ramp is faster cycling of the ramp.
